It's Oktoberfest weekend in Des Moines! Oktoberfest Des Moines kicks off at 4:00pm today with the tapping of the Golden Keg and continues through Saturday night. Lots of great polka music, fun contests, and of course, plenty of German beer. You'll find the tents at 4th Street south of Court Avenue. Tickets will be available at the door for $10 and include a mug and your first beer.

Another great beer event coming up is Peace Tree Brewing Company's Brews & Muse on October 8th. It will feature their great beers on tap as well as a couple of special beers brewed just for this event. Lots of music and a poster contest to benefit the Red Rock Arts Alliance is also planned. There will be some BBQ available and also the Gusto Pizza Co. trailer will be there.
